Don't make the lines to fine or close together. The marks get larger over the years and fine line designs get harder to see. Don't scratch at the tattoo when it is healing no matter how much it itches. you could foul it up. Make it colourful or make sure it can be colourized later. Never put your boyfriends name on your butt. Or your girlfriend's name on your chest or arms. Tattoos often last longer than relationships. Try to get it where it can be covered when you want to cover it but shown off without being totaly naked when you want to show it. In other words covered by formal wear.

don't try to find a pre-existing design to go by. Design something yourself, think about what is most significant in your life. Take your ideas to a GOOD tattoo artist and ask them to put together a few drafts, choose a few you like. then you can build on the design you like most, add things, take away shapes or shadows.....a good artist will work with you until you are satisfied with the outcome.

One word of caution. Choose a place for your tattoo that is not visible when wearing summer clothing. Most people don't realize it is very hard to get a good job if you have tatts that show.
